diff --git a/src/components/layout/Header.tsx b/src/components/layout/Header.tsx index 03cb0407..fbd89e3f 100644 --- a/src/components/layout/Header.tsx +++ b/src/components/layout/Header.tsx @@ -31,9 +31,9 @@ export function Header() { return ( <>
-
+
{/* Mobile: Menu + Logo */} -
+
{/* Mobile Menu */} @@ -108,8 +108,8 @@ export function Header() { {/* Logo */} - - + + ThrillWiki @@ -215,9 +215,9 @@ export function Header() {
{/* Right side: Search, Theme, Auth */} -
+
{/* Desktop Search */} -
+
@@ -225,7 +225,7 @@ export function Header() { @@ -227,15 +227,16 @@ export function AutocompleteSearch({ {isHero && ( )}
{isOpen && displayItems.length > 0 && ( -
+
{query.length === 0 && showRecentSearches && suggestions.length > 0 && ( <> diff --git a/src/components/search/MobileSearch.tsx b/src/components/search/MobileSearch.tsx index d549a7d7..ab110375 100644 --- a/src/components/search/MobileSearch.tsx +++ b/src/components/search/MobileSearch.tsx @@ -23,24 +23,24 @@ export function MobileSearch({ open, onOpenChange }: MobileSearchProps) {
{/* Search Header */} -
-
+
+
-
- +
+ setQuery(e.target.value)} - className="pl-10 h-11 text-base" + className="pl-10 pr-3 h-11 text-sm w-full" />
diff --git a/src/components/search/SearchDropdown.tsx b/src/components/search/SearchDropdown.tsx index 80add1fd..7700e7e2 100644 --- a/src/components/search/SearchDropdown.tsx +++ b/src/components/search/SearchDropdown.tsx @@ -42,25 +42,25 @@ export function SearchDropdown() { }; return ( -
-
- +
+
+
{isOpen && ( -
+
)} diff --git a/src/components/ui/input.tsx b/src/components/ui/input.tsx index 09700f60..fa419a45 100644 --- a/src/components/ui/input.tsx +++ b/src/components/ui/input.tsx @@ -8,7 +8,7 @@ const Input = React.forwardRef>(